Is Cobalt An Ion Or Atom?
Cobalt is a chemical element – a substance that contains only one type of atom. Its official chemical symbol is Co and its atomic number is 27, which means that a cobalt atom has 27 protons in its nucleus.

What type of ion does cobalt form?
Chemical Properties
However cobalt does not react with water that is at room temperature. The simplest ion that cobalt forms in solution is the pink hexaaquacobalt(II) ion – [Co(H2O)6]2+.
Is cobalt molecular or ionic?
Cobalt is a metal. It forms ionic compounds such as CoCl2. If also forms compounds containing complex ions, such as [Co(H2O)6]Cl2, in which there are covalent bonds between the cobalt ion and the ligand, H2O.
What is Cobalts charge as an ion?
Cobalt (Co) is another element that can form more than one possible charged ion (2+ and 3+), while lead (Pb) can form 2+ or 4+ cations.

What is cobalt ion used for?
This element is used in numerous industrial applications like welding, diamond tooling, grinding, chemical catalyses, and nuclear power plants [3, 4]. In nuclear plants, it can occur in two radioactive forms of cobalt, 58Co and 60Co, which are formed from corrosion-erosion of alloys containing cobalt and other metals.
What is cobalt made of?
Cobalt is not found as a free metal and is generally found in the form of ores. Cobalt is usually not mined alone, and tends to be produced as a by-product of nickel and copper mining activities. The main ores of cobalt are cobaltite, erythrite, glaucodot, and skutterudite.
What turns an atom into an ion?
Ions form when atoms gain or lose electrons. Since electrons are negatively charged, an atom that loses one or more electrons will become positively charged; an atom that gains one or more electrons becomes negatively charged. Ionic bonding is the attraction between positively- and negatively-charged ions.
Is cobalt a complex ion?
The chemical reaction demonstrated herein involves the formation of complex ions between Co2+ and water molecules or chlo- ride ions, respectively. A solution of cobalt(II) ion in water is pink, the color of the complex ion formed between Co2+ ions and water molecules.
